Transaction: 24c670d0b76d26abfef6e6b2857d9a4a27b07e0e5628f0c135ced817b75cf5e7

Block Hash: 00000089d256c033b8c4985b3409c697fb08f96020d0160e65109506a1a411eb

Confirmations: 3041154

Timestamp: 2017-04-25 22:28:24

Amount: 22.77

Is Block Reward: Yes

Reward Type: PoW

Inputs

Sender Address Amount
Coinbase ( PoW) 22.77

Outputs

Recipient Address Amount
ScssQXmRB7azVasYDPPncG2KRPoUVSxMTC 22.77